Abstract

The utility model discloses a safety inspection early warning device which is arranged on a physiological inspection robot, wherein the safety inspection early warning device comprises a crank mechanism, a swinging mechanism and an early warning mechanism, the early warning mechanism is symmetrically arranged on the shoulder of the physiological inspection robot, the swinging mechanism is symmetrically arranged on two sides of the physiological inspection robot, the crank mechanism is arranged between the swinging mechanism and the early warning mechanism, the swinging mechanism is connected with the crank mechanism through a fixed rod, the swinging rod of the swinging mechanism is driven to swing continuously forwards and backwards through a motor in the early warning mechanism on the physiological inspection robot to attract medical care attention, and the continuously-prompted attention of medical staff or patients is reminded through the switching of two colors of an indicator lamp, so that the early warning function can be ensured; in addition, the device can not generate obvious noise when in work, and can provide a quiet and good rest environment for patients.

Background
The medical safety management of the hospital has the following core: the satisfaction degree of patients on nursing services is improved, the occurrence of complications of the patients is reduced, and the safety of the patients is ensured. And the early detection of the major complications can greatly reduce the accident rate, ICU occupancy rate and death rate of patients, shorten average hospitalization days, reduce hospitalization cost of the patients and reduce the waste of medical resources. Medical personnel are therefore increasingly concerned with and paying attention to "potentially critically ill patients". A number of retrospective studies in the united kingdom found: most common sick area patients have obvious early warning signals before the illness state changes are transferred into the ICU or before respiratory cardiac arrest occurs, and most of the early warning signals clinically show shortness of breath, change of consciousness state, arrhythmia, blood pressure fluctuation, arterial oxygen saturation and abnormal urine volume, and most of the early warning signals can be observed within 24 hours before serious adverse events occur. While researchers have found at the same time: nurses often fail to timely discover these signals and inform the doctor that improper care is taking place. On one hand, the reason is related to insufficient knowledge and experience of nurses; on the other hand, nurses report the illness state to doctors with inaccurate expression or insufficient expression, so that the doctors cannot trust and process in time.
Then the existing early warning device prompts medical staff and patients to visit through the flashing of the voice alarm and the indicator lamp, but when the medical staff is busy or some special patients to visit can not pay attention to early warning information, and noise is disordered and smells to feel bad. The noise intensity is 50-60 dB, and the people feel noisy, and the people can feel headache, dizziness, tinnitus, insomnia and the like under the long-time effect of more than 90 dB. In order to ensure that a patient has a quiet and good resting environment, noise in a ward should be reduced as much as possible, and the patient is kept quiet, however, the existing device prompts medical staff through a broadcaster and can influence the rest of the patient.

Hereinafter, an embodiment of the present utility model will be described in accordance with its entire structure.
Referring to fig. 1-5, a safety inspection early warning device is arranged on a physiological inspection robot 5, the safety inspection early warning device comprises a crank mechanism 1, a swinging mechanism 2 and an early warning mechanism 3, the early warning mechanism 3 is symmetrically arranged on the shoulder of the physiological inspection robot 5, the swinging mechanism 2 is symmetrically arranged on two sides of the physiological inspection robot 5, the crank mechanism 1 is arranged between the swinging mechanism 2 and the early warning mechanism 3, and the swinging mechanism 2 is connected with the crank mechanism 1 through a fixed rod 4.
Specifically, the rocking mechanism 2 comprises two rocking rods 23, the rocking rods 23 are vertically arranged on two sides of the physiological inspection robot 5, a first connecting rod 22 is hinged to the end part of each rocking rod 23, a strip-shaped opening for the first connecting rod (22) to move is formed in the hinged part of each rocking rod (23), and the other end of each rocking rod 23 is fixedly connected with the fixed rod 4.
Specifically, the early warning mechanism 3 includes a housing 31, the housing 31 is fixed on the physiological inspection robot 5 through an L-shaped plate 32, a rotary table 38 is provided in the housing 31, a motor 37 fixedly connected with the housing 31 is provided on the rotary table 38, and an output shaft of the motor 37 is fixedly connected with the rotary table 38.
Specifically, a contact plate 36 is fixedly disposed above the motor 37, a carrier plate 39 is disposed above the contact plate 36, and the rotary table 38 is connected to an eccentric position of the carrier plate 39 through a fixing column 310.
Specifically, the curved bar mechanism 1 includes a sliding rail 12, the sliding rail 12 is fixed on the shoulder of the physiological inspection robot 5, a sliding block 11 is slidably connected on the sliding rail 12, a second connecting rod 13 is arranged on the sliding block 11, the second connecting rod 13 is fixedly connected with a curved bar 14, a third connecting rod 6 is connected at the eccentric position of the rotating table 38, the other end of the third connecting rod 6 is connected with the curved bar 14, and the sliding block 11 is fixedly connected with the fixed rod 4.
Specifically, the carrier plate 39 is provided with an indicator lamp 34, at least two indicator lamps 34 are distributed on the carrier plate 39 in an annular equidistant manner, the end of the indicator lamp 34 is provided with a stationary contact, and the contact plate 36 is provided with a movable contact corresponding to the stationary contact of the indicator lamp 34.
The specific operation flow of the utility model is as follows:
when the device is used, the physiological inspection robot 5 is required to be placed in an area to be inspected, the physiological inspection robot 5 can inspect physiological health of blood pressure, body temperature, heart rate and the like of a patient to be inspected, the central processing unit is used for processing the detected data, the central processing unit is used for analyzing and processing whether the physiological health of the patient to be inspected is problematic, if so, the central processing unit is used for electrifying the alarm device, the alarm device is electrified with the early warning mechanism 3 (the circuit of the movable contact and the stationary contact is electrified), the output shaft of the motor 37 in the early warning mechanism 3 is rotated, the output shaft of the motor 37 is fixedly connected with the rotary table 38, the rotary table 38 is driven to rotate by the rotation of the output shaft of the motor 37, the rotary table 38 is connected with the carrier plate 39 through the fixed column 310, the contact plate 36 is fixedly arranged above the motor 37, (the periphery of the contact plate 36 is an insulator), so the rotary table 38 can drive the carrier plate 39 to rotate, the indicator lamp 34 is fixed on the carrier plate 39, the carrier plate 39 and the contact plate 36 are eccentrically arranged, the movable contact connected with the end part of the indicator lamp 34 is contacted with the stationary contact on the contact plate 36, the indicator lamp 34 can be lightened, at least two of the indicator lamps 34 are annularly and equally distributed on the carrier plate 39, the indicator lamps 34 have different colors, the indicator lamp 34 can flash different colors, the third connecting rod 6 is fixed below the rotary table 38, because the third connecting rod 6 is connected with the curved rod 14, the curved rod 14 is connected with the second connecting rod 13, the second connecting rod 13 is fixed on the sliding block 11, the rotary table 38 can drive the sliding block 11 to reciprocate on the sliding rail 12, the sliding block 11 is connected with the rocking rod 23 through the fixed rod 4, the sliding block 11 can drive the rocking rod 23 to do rocking motion, thereby generating an alarm to alert the patient and doctor to the reminder.
